Inequalities · Multi-step · 3.4
Mixed practice: distribute if needed, gather x’s on one side and numbers on the other, then divide — flipping the sign only when you divide by a negative. Same toolkit, harder problems.

Solve for x: -6x ≥ 30
The inequality
Solve for x just like an equation — with one twist. -6x ≥ 30
Flip the sign!
Dividing both sides by the negative -6 reverses the inequality. x ≤ -5

Skipping a step under pressure.
Work in order: distribute, gather, divide.
Missing the flip.
Check the sign of the coefficient before dividing.
